SPXCN Tracking Number Meaning
Learn what SPXCN format usually indicates, how to verify the number, and what timeline behavior to expect.
Last reviewed: March 10, 2026
What to do
- SPXCN generally refers to a SpeedX-linked cross-border tracking format.
- Always copy the full code from carrier or marketplace shipment details.
- Cross-border SPXCN updates may post in batches during customs and linehaul stages.
- A 24-48 hour scan gap can be normal between export and destination processing.
- If no movement appears for 5+ days, contact seller with order ID and full tracking screenshot.
